Algorithmic advantages of high interaction rates
Instagram’s algorithm doesn’t just favor popular content-it rewards speed. Posts that gain likes, shares, and especially comments within the first hour are far more likely to be pushed onto the Explore page. This early surge signals relevance, triggering what’s often called the “snowball effect”: more visibility leads to more organic engagement, which in turn leads to even greater reach. Content synchronization for maximum impact
Timing is everything. The first 60 minutes after posting-often called the “golden hour”-are when Instagram decides whether to amplify your content. Launching a comment campaign during this window ensures your post enters the algorithm with momentum. Ideally, the first few comments should appear within 10-15 minutes of upload. This signals immediate interest and increases the odds of being featured in Explore or suggested feeds. Scheduling is key: align your purchase with your posting schedule, not the other way around.

Measuring and refining your growth tactics
After launching a campaign, track key performance indicators: reach, impressions, profile visits, and-most importantly-organic follower growth. Did the post attract new followers who weren’t previously engaged? Did it lead to higher engagement on subsequent uploads? These metrics reveal whether the boost had a lasting effect or was just a temporary spike. Use these insights to refine future campaigns: which types of content respond best? Which audiences engage most? Over time, this data-driven approach turns paid engagement into a strategic tool, not a one-off trick.
